Advanced Features

  • Multiple Modes: Besides standard rounding, choose "Round Up," "Round Down," or "Round Half Even" to suit various business needs.
  • Batch Processing: For large datasets, enter one number per line; the tool processes them automatically, outputting a clear list to save you time.
  • Precision Options: Round to integer positions (e.g., nearest ten) or specify significant digits, flexible for scientific contexts.

FAQ

Q: How to round to whole number? Set precision to 0, e.g., 12.6 becomes 13.
Q: How are negative numbers handled? By default, rounding applies to the absolute value; e.g., -2.5 to integer yields -3 (standard mode). You can switch modes to adjust.
Q: Can the tool handle very large or small numbers? Yes, it supports exponential forms like 1.25e-4.
